技术文摘
python语法入门之导入import与from的代码示例
python语法入门之导入import与from的代码示例
在Python编程中,导入模块是一项非常重要的操作,它允许我们使用其他人编写的代码,大大提高了编程效率。本文将通过代码示例详细介绍Python中导入模块的两种常见方式:import和from。
1. 使用import导入模块
import语句用于导入整个模块,语法格式为:import module_name。以下是一个简单的示例,演示如何使用import导入Python的内置数学模块math并使用其中的函数:
import math
# 使用math模块中的sqrt函数计算平方根
num = 16
square_root = math.sqrt(num)
print(f"16的平方根是:{square_root}")
# 使用math模块中的pi常量
circle_area = math.pi * (num / 2) ** 2
print(f"半径为8的圆的面积是:{circle_area}")
在上述代码中,我们首先使用import math导入了math模块,然后通过math.的方式来访问模块中的函数和常量。
2. 使用from导入模块中的特定成员
from语句用于从模块中导入特定的函数、类或变量,语法格式为:from module_name import member_name。以下是一个示例:
from math import sqrt, pi
# 直接使用导入的sqrt函数和pi常量
num = 16
square_root = sqrt(num)
print(f"16的平方根是:{square_root}")
circle_area = pi * (num / 2) ** 2
print(f"半径为8的圆的面积是:{circle_area}")
在这个示例中,我们使用from math import sqrt, pi只导入了math模块中的sqrt函数和pi常量,这样在使用时就无需再加上模块名前缀。
3. 总结
import和from是Python中导入模块的两种常用方式。import导入整个模块,使用时需要通过模块名来访问其中的成员;from可以选择性地导入模块中的特定成员,使用时无需模块名前缀。根据实际需求选择合适的导入方式,可以使代码更加简洁和高效。掌握这两种导入方式对于Python编程至关重要,是进一步学习和开发的基础。
TAGS: 代码示例 python语法入门 导入import 导入from
- C# 实现 Word 中插入与删除分节符的技术指引
- AWK 进阶指南:掌握利用 AWK index 函数查找子字符串的技巧
- Nginx 怎样解决惊群效应,你知道吗?
- Express.js 5.0 重磅发布 依旧断层领先
- 转转推荐场景中因果推断的实践应用
- C# 中的顶级语句浅析,你是否了解?
- 面试官:线程通讯的实现方式
- 面试官:详述停止线程池的执行步骤
- 遗传算法的原理与 Python 实现探讨
- 为何许多人不建议使用 JWT ?
- Redis 的 RDB 和 AOF 持久化机制
- 暗水印显隐技术推动生产排障增效
- JSON 包新提案:“omitzero”化解编码空值难题
- 操作系统的启动过程是怎样的?
- SpringBoot 异步接口实践:提升系统吞吐量